Kuala Lumpur is Malaysia's economic epicentre and the country's largest employment hub. Home to the Petronas Twin Towers, KLCC business district, and Bangsar South tech corridor, KL hosts the headquarters of most Fortune 500 companies operating in Southeast Asia.
The city's job market spans every sector — from financial services along Jalan Raja Chulan to tech startups in Bangsar and media agencies in Mont Kiara. KL's well-connected LRT, MRT, and monorail system makes commuting manageable, and the city's multicultural workforce operates in English, Malay, and Mandarin.
According to DOSM's Household Income Survey 2024, Kuala Lumpur has the highest median household income in Malaysia at approximately RM 10,800/month, reflecting the concentration of high-paying professional roles in the capital.
KL commands the highest salaries in Malaysia. Fresh graduates typically earn RM 2,500–3,500/month (up to RM 4,000+ in tech and finance), mid-career professionals RM 5,000–10,000/month, and senior executives RM 15,000–30,000+/month. Financial services, tech, and consulting pay the highest premiums.
Top hiring areas include the Golden Triangle (KLCC, Bukit Bintang), Bangsar South (TM, Astro, tech firms), KL Sentral (transport hub employers), and Mid Valley (retail and F&B). The growing TRX Exchange area is attracting global financial institutions.
